About Great River City Light Rail

Western Sydney is one of the fastest growing regions in our country, with the population of Greater Parramatta alone set to climb by 50 per cent by 2041 and at Great River City Light Rail we want to create new communities, connect great places and help locals and visitors move around and explore what the region has to offer. The new Light Rail will connect Westmead to Carlingford via the Parramatta CBD and Camellia, spanning 12 kilometres and utilising state-of-the-art vehicles that delivers comfortable, user-friendly and high-performance services. By 2026, around 28,000 people will use Parramatta Light Rail every day and an estimated 130,000 people will be living within walking distance of light rail stops.


The role

Reporting to the Electrical Supervisor, you will be responsible for all maintenance activities related to substations and overhead wiring line assets for the network. This will include maintenance on traction power systems assets and low voltage equipment and carrying out 11KV high voltage and 750V DC operational switching and isolation activities. In addition, you will be responsible for writing, issuing and checking electrical work instructions for the team.


What you bring

Whilst this role is focused on High Voltage maintenance, we are open to your industry experience. This role requires the candidate to have an Electrical Licence, and if you are in rail, a certificate III in either Rail Traction or Distribution Overhead is desirable. However, we are also looking for Electricians from both the commercial and industrial sectors who are willing to be developed through on the job learning and supported by the business, to obtain a high voltage isolation & access licence. Regardless of industry background, your high-level problem-solving skills will allow you to manage difficult situations including responding to emergencies and restoring assets after incidents. This will be supported by the ability carry out asset inspections and undertake fault finding and ensure asset reliability.
